About the United Kingdom ETA

The UK ETA (Electronic Travel Authorisation) is a digital travel permit for visa-exempt nationals visiting the United Kingdom. It links electronically to your passport and is required for short stays including tourism, business meetings, and transit.

Requirements

  • Valid passport from an eligible nationality
  • Recent digital photograph meeting UK specifications
  • Valid email address for ETA delivery
  • Credit or debit card for payment
  • No criminal convictions or immigration violations
  • Intent to leave the UK within 6 months per visit

The UK ETA is required for nationals of countries that do not need a visa for short visits to the UK. This includes citizens of the United States, Canada, Australia, Japan, and many other countries. Check your eligibility on our form.

Each visit can last up to 6 months. The ETA itself is valid for 2 years or until your passport expires (whichever comes first), allowing multiple trips.

No, the UK ETA is for tourism, visiting family, business meetings, short-term study (up to 6 months), and transit. For work purposes, you need a separate work visa.

Yes, every traveler including infants and children must have their own ETA linked to their individual passport.

Yes, the UK ETA covers all parts of the United Kingdom: England, Scotland, Wales, and Northern Ireland.
